How many years must brokers on the Florida Real Estate Commission have held active licenses?

Prepare for the Florida Broker Exam. Study with interactive quizzes, flashcards, and multiple choice questions that include hints and explanations. Ace your exam and start your real estate career today!

Brokers serving on the Florida Real Estate Commission must have held an active real estate license for a minimum of five years. This requirement ensures that commission members have adequate experience and a deep understanding of the real estate industry, which is crucial for making informed decisions and regulations that affect the profession. The five-year period allows brokers to gain substantial experience in different market conditions, legal issues, and ethical practices in real estate, which enriches the quality of oversight they can provide.
